Consultation and Personalized Planning

A Botox consultation is important for creating a personalized treatment plan. During this meeting, you’ll discuss your goals, areas of concern like fine lines or crow’s feet, and any medical conditions. This is the time to set realistic expectations and learn about the specific types of neuromodulators available, such as Xeomin or Dysport.

The consultation lets the provider assess your facial structure and explain how different treatment areas can achieve a youthful appearance. A good provider listens to your concerns and helps you understand how Botox works. This enables you to make informed choices about your treatments.

Preparing for Botox Injections

Before getting Botox, plan your appointment carefully. Avoid alcohol and blood-thinning medications for a few days before your treatment to reduce the risk of bruising. Inform your provider about any existing medical conditions like migraines or allergies, especially if Botox is part of treatment for medical issues.

Assure your face is clean and free from makeup on the day of the procedure. Discuss areas of concern, such as crow’s feet or forehead lines, with your provider. This chat helps tailor the treatment to your needs, whether targeting deep wrinkles or looking for more natural-looking results.

Post-Treatment Expectations and Care

After the procedure, avoid lying down flat for four to six hours to prevent the Botox from spreading to unintended areas. Refrain from touching the injection site to avoid irritation. Avoid exercise, saunas, or hot tubs for at least 24 hours, as these can affect the results.

You might experience temporary side effects like mild swelling or soreness. These are usual and typically pass quickly. Follow any specific aftercare instructions your provider gives to help ensure a smooth recovery. In some cases, you might see changes in facial expressions as the Botox takes effect on the facial muscles, but these changes usually fade over time.
